Latest Patents
Zhu's latest patents include a system for coordinated voltage control and reactive power regulation between transmission and distribution systems. This invention describes methods for coordinating volt-var control, allowing distributed energy resources to be aggregated into virtual power plants. These resources can optimally dispatch reactive power to minimize voltage fluctuations in the sub-transmission system. His second patent focuses on sizing the capacity of energy storage devices. This method involves generating load profiles and determining values of cumulative distribution functions to effectively size energy storage based on user-generated data.
